Average Payroll and Timekeeping Clerks Salary in Nashville-Davidson--Murfreesboro--Franklin, TN

In Nashville-Davidson--Murfreesboro--Franklin, TN, Payroll and Timekeeping Clerks earn an average annual salary of $55,210. This figure is slightly below the national average of $56,360, indicating a minor disparity that can be influenced by local economic factors and the specific demand within the region's diverse industries. The concentration of these roles within the Nashville metropolitan area plays a key role in shaping compensation.

Payroll and Timekeeping Clerks Salary Distribution in Nashville-Davidson--Murfreesboro--Franklin, TN

Career progression for Payroll and Timekeeping Clerks in Nashville-Davidson--Murfreesboro--Franklin, TN, typically involves a significant salary increase with experience. Entry-level positions may start closer to the lower percentiles, while senior clerks with extensive experience and specialized skills can command salaries well into the higher percentiles, reflecting a clear path for career advancement and increased earning potential.
